Remove a PCIe adapter
Follow instructions in this section to remove a PCIe adapter.
About this task
To avoid potential danger, make sure to read and follow the safety information.
Attention: Read
“Installation Guidelines” on page 41 and “Safety inspection checklist” on page 42 to make
sure that you work safely.
Note: Depending on the specific configuration, the hardware might look slightly different from the
illustrations in this section.
Procedure
Step 1. Make preparations for this task.
a. Power off the node (see
“Power off the node” on page 51); then, disconnect all external cables
from the node.
b. Remove the node from the chassis (see
“Remove a node from the chassis” on page 72); then,
carefully lay the node on a flat, static-protective surface, orienting the node with the front
toward you.
